How to Clone Your Voice with AI in 2026 (Free and Paid Options)

AI voice cloning crossed the uncanny valley in 2024. In 2026, cloning your own voice takes 30 seconds of source audio and one click. Used responsibly, it's a superpower. Used poorly, it's a fraud risk.

Best paid option: ElevenLabs.

$5/month Starter gets you instant voice cloning with the new v3 multilingual model. Voices generated are nearly indistinguishable from the source — even in languages you don't speak. The API is excellent.

Best free option: ElevenLabs free tier

(10,000 characters/month, English only) or OpenAI Voice Engine (still in limited preview but worth applying).

Best for open-source / local: Coqui XTTS-v2

runs on your own GPU. Lower quality than ElevenLabs but zero data leaves your machine.

How to clone your voice in 5 minutes

Record 30 seconds of clean audio. Read varied sentences with full pitch range. Upload to ElevenLabs. Generate. Tweak stability and similarity sliders. Done.

Responsible use

Always disclose AI voices in commercial work. Many platforms (YouTube, Spotify) now require it. Never clone a voice you don't have explicit permission to use — laws around 'voice rights' are tightening fast, especially in California and the EU.

Real use cases

narrating long-form content, dubbing your videos into other languages, podcast intro variations, accessibility voiceovers for blog posts. Voice cloning has matured into a serious creator tool.

The deepfake problem

voice fraud is up 600% YoY. If a family member calls asking for money, hang up and call them back on a known number. A safe-word system within families is a smart 2026 hygiene.
